repo-wiki
repo-wiki is a Node.js CLI and library that compiles a Git repository into a source-grounded wiki knowledge base for humans and coding agents.
It follows the LLM Wiki pattern described in docs/PLAN.md: scan the repository at a pinned commit, ingest markdown as secondary evidence, compile durable wiki pages, and lint the result before publishing. GitHub Wiki is the primary publication target today, and GitHub Pages is also supported.

Documentation authority model
Code at the pinned commit is authoritative. Tests, CI/configuration, and generated schemas are stronger evidence than markdown. Markdown docs are still ingested because they often contain intent, terminology, onboarding, and runbook context.
The default documentation config is loaded from src/config.ts and includes:
documentation.ingest=trueauthority="secondary"- include patterns for
README.md,docs/**/*.md,ADR/**/*.md, and.github/**/*.md - default lint behavior for stale docs, contradicted docs, broken file references, unvalidated env vars, and unvalidated route claims
repo-wiki lint-docs validates documented package scripts/commands, checks relative links and referenced repo paths, and compares route/API claims against scanner-extracted route surfaces when available.
Deterministic and LLM compilation
The default compiler mode is deterministic.
LLM mode is also shipped:
- set
compiler.modetollmin.llmwiki/config.json, or - export
LLMWIKI_COMPILER_MODE=llm
In LLM mode:
- module pages and
Architecture.mdare synthesized through the provider boundary - generated output must pass structured wiki-patch validation before it is written
- foundation and cross-cutting pages remain deterministic today
- the mock provider is still useful for tests and CI, while hosted mode uses the OpenAI-compatible provider

Current status and near-term gaps
The current package ships a working CLI, scanner, docs linting, deterministic compiler, LLM page synthesis path, wiki linting, publisher, and CI workflows.
Still planned rather than shipped are user-facing doctor, diff, backend graph adapters (for example Neo4j/SQLite), filed-back query pages, hosted answer synthesis, and runtime transport surfaces described in docs/PLAN.md and docs/plans/wiki-graph.md. The shipped search/query/path/explain surfaces are built-in local page-first commands; external adapters and richer file-back layers remain deferred.
